Why this name?
When i just started school this kid said i looked like a fly and u know i guess it was a way for the other kids to pick on me...actually he said i looked like a turbo fly...and it was such a dumb name that it stuck....turbo fly.Later on in the skool years though when i started getting respect i guess they shortened it to t-fly. So im just rolling with a name that i was blessed wit. I made a dumb name cool
How, do you think, does the internet (or mp3) change the music industry?
Yeah it does....it costs artists money u know the bootlegging and stuff. But there's the positive side to your music goes worldwide and you can influence people who couldnt afford to buy your music but needed to listen to you to get through the day.
Would you sign a record contract with a major label?
Yeah i would...i guess we'll so who's interested
Your influences?
I listen to a whole lot of different kinds of music...i guess thats the producer side of me.I want to adopt the best parts of all diferent genres.and that in itself helps my rapping.i listen to trip hop artists like portishead.hardcore rock like greenday.softer alternative rock like michelle branch. i listen to whatever is lyrically rich....rap artist i listen to are talib kwali, mos def, kanye west,jadakiss... and people tend to think you can't gain inspiration from new rap artists, they think u gotta listen to and idolize tupac and biggie or else u aint a rapper but i get inspired by new school artists too, i mean u can't reach the future by standing in the past so i listen to new cats like cassidy and fabolous.....

and as far as my tupac inspiration goes...lol...i have never listened to a full tupac album well excep the latest one "loyal to the game"...don't get me wrong i mean tupac was great...but i rather tupac the poet than tupac the rapper ....i could read his poetry books over and over again for days

oh and i play the guitar too so my biggest influence there is carlos santana
Favorite spot?
st.lucia for sure
